skidrow wrote:I see what you mean. The element for the 12v circuit must be under powered to save the energy but just really wastes it.
If the 120 volt circuit draws 3 amps, that's 360 watts, which would be 30 amps in 12 volts for equivalent heating power. That's quite a bit of current and would require some pretty heavy gauge wiring from the alt to the fridge, then within the fridge. It may also require an upgraded alternator.

Better to just run propane, or if you already have the generator going for the rooftop A/C, just run the 120 volt mode of the fridge, too.
